When it comes to losing positions, the pound has undoubtedly shown itself here. To make matters worse, the signals practically doubled on several pairs with this currency. From a strictly technical point of view, in my opinion, the upward trend is still in place. I wanted to join the traffic, but the corrections turned out to be too big, so they passed the positions stop loss. I played on GBPUSD, GBPCAD and GBPCHF. What prompted me to open my position in all three cases was getting the price to an interesting level of support, combined with overbalance, i.e. the equality of corrections in the current trend. Unfortunately, the price went down and the positions were closed. I never increase stop loss by force, sometimes you have to accept that the price goes in a different direction than we expect. Such situations in trading happen and will happen.
As for profitable positions, short on was definitely the best EURJPY. The pair reached strong resistance around 122.430, after which the price went back a lot. The candle's body was very small, in addition the candle had a long upper shadow. I set up a pending sell limit order that was activated two days later. The price moved down as planned. After a few days, the transaction earned almost 6% (5,7%) and after adjusting up it was closed for take profit.
